Transaction b5100409f3a0d0f682430b0a26562cc5a51c40440b3ddeaaa8eda89ddf42c566

87 Input
2 Outputs
  • b5100409f3a0d0f682430b0a26562cc5a51c40440b3ddeaaa8eda89ddf42c566:0
  • value  800207
    address  32sartEuyRYBThhsRqVUg8FgAVuDFFrKYN
  • b5100409f3a0d0f682430b0a26562cc5a51c40440b3ddeaaa8eda89ddf42c566:1
  • value  657660861
    address  38MxN2Smndw9g47CfSoThBdJtNvRyrgyjs